Net Zero Leaders Thrive on Climate Risk – Robeco

Chris Hall

Companies leading the way in the net zero transition deliver higher average returns during periods of anomalous high temperatures and climate policy uncertainty compared to laggards, according to asset manager Robeco. . Delta Appoints Amelia DeLuca as Chief Sustainability Officer

ESG Today

According to the airline, in her new role, DeLuca will lead the airline on its commitment to achieve net zero emissions by 2050, while delivering “a more sustainable and elevated travel experience.” DeLuca first joined Delta in 2006, and has held a series of senior roles, including serving as Vice President, Sustainability.
